Discussion Overview
The discussion revolves around the pathways to a career in engineering, particularly the foundational education required and the relationship between physics and various engineering disciplines. Participants explore the implications of choosing a physics degree versus an engineering degree and the potential career outcomes associated with each.

Main Points Raised
- One participant expresses uncertainty about which type of engineering to pursue and questions whether an undergraduate degree in physics could lead to an engineering job.
- Another participant suggests that while some individuals with physics degrees find engineering jobs, this is less common, especially in civil or mechanical engineering, and emphasizes the differences in curriculum between physics and engineering.
- A third participant highlights the overlap between physics and materials science/engineering, noting that materials science involves manipulating material properties for practical applications.
- Some participants recommend pursuing an engineering degree directly for better job prospects in engineering fields, while others mention the possibility of entering an "engineering-undecided" track in university.
- There is mention of engineering physics programs that combine engineering courses with physics, which may provide a suitable alternative for those interested in both fields.
- One participant points out that many universities offer a general first year for engineering students to explore different branches before declaring a specific discipline.
- Another participant suggests that one could major in physics or engineering physics and later specialize in a particular engineering discipline, though this may require significant effort.
Areas of Agreement / Disagreement
Participants generally agree that pursuing an engineering degree is advisable for those seeking engineering jobs, but there is disagreement on the viability of a physics degree as a pathway into engineering roles. Multiple competing views exist regarding the overlap between physics and engineering, particularly in materials science.
